Ferrari Part Number 102947 in Ferrari 512 BBi Table 13 Cooling System

$13.00

Product Description

Ferrari Part 102947, FUEL PUMP MOUNTING, shown here as used in Ferrari 512 BBi Table 13 Cooling System. Other uses of this part are shown below:

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947

Ferrari Part 102947